How this hub is built. This page collects 3 recall events tied to Arrow International (across 47 product-line records) in the current 411 Press recall dataset. A note on counting. The three agencies package recalls differently. NHTSA issues one record per safety campaign; the CPSC issues one per recall; the FDA issues one per affected product line, so a single FDA recall can appear as dozens of records. Counting raw records would push FDA-heavy brands artificially to the top. The counts here are recall EVENTS — distinct agency events — with the FDA product-line record total shown alongside wherever the two differ. Records are grouped by a normalized version of the recalling firm's name (normalizer version 2026-07-28.C3.2). Parent, subsidiary, and "doing business as" relationships are not merged unless the agency data states them, so a corporate family can appear under more than one name. Regulator for these records: FDA. They were published 2026–2026. An event count reflects how much recall activity fell inside the current dataset — not a ranking of relative safety. Larger manufacturers and higher-volume product lines generate more recall activity. This is the current dataset, not an all-time total, and it grows as new notices are ingested.   • Class I

    NextStep Antegrade Chronic Hemodialysis Catheter

    16F dual-valved splittable sheath introducer, the subject of a supplier recall, was included in impacted hemodialysis kits & sets. Sheath introducer may not split as intended, and may result in withdrawal resistance, prolonged procedure time, pain, bleeding, hematoma, tissue injury, vessel wall injury.
